Event: Let’s talk about Human Rights in Mexico: Ayotzinapa’s 43 Disappeared Students

 

print-A4-parlamento-event-feb

Liberation, Jeremy Corbyn MP, Cathy Jamieson MP, and Justice Mexico Now,are hosting an event at Portcullis House, on Human Rights in Mexico on the 24th of February 2015 at 7pm (please arrive 6.30 to pass security). This event takes place in the context of the dual year Mexico-UK 2015 which focus on trade, investment and culture, but largely overlooks the Human Right’s crisis in Mexico. The meeting aims to launch a Campaign for Human Rights in Mexico, called Justice in Mexico Now’ to demand an end to impunity and to Human Rights abuses in the country.

The speakers will cover the recent case of the 43 students from Ayotzinapa and their enforced disappearance by the mayor and local police in Guerrero, Mexico, the extrajudicial killings by the military like those at the State of Mexico, violence against journalists and activists, impunity rates, and a preliminar report from one of the participants at the Misión de Observación Civil that took place in November last year.
